CONSTRUCTION The 587 mm SOSR Launch Pad will be a reinforced concrete structure consisting of a 2-ft. thick rectangular foundation, three individual vertical piers 15-ft. high and a 2-ft. thick upper cap which connects the three piers at the top. Located on the foundation and behind the piers will be a 30-inch high Rear Pivot Pedestal, and behind the pedestal will be a 6-ft. deep Spin Motor Pit. An electrical alcove will be located on the east side of the east pier. The launch pad will be oriented on a true azimuth of S 11° W. Five survey markers will be required 50-ft. to the rear of the Rear Pivot Pedestal and on a line normal to the azimuth of the launch pad. The launch control console for firing will be located in the Control Bunker and Converter Shelter Building No. 737. All cabling from the electrical alcove to the launch control console will be installed in conduit. A grounding system will be installed completely around the launch pad with grounding cable extending to critical points on the launch pad. Power to the electrical alcove will consist of 110 volt, 60 cycle, single phase and is required for: area lighting, 110 volt power outlets, and remote power relays. The area lighting will consist of 35~foot high floodlights located on each side of the launch pad. 1-97 aE VOLI April 1969
